First, what exactly is polyvinyl alcohol powder? Simply put, it’s a water-soluble synthetic polymer that has garnered attention for its unique properties. Used in films, coatings, and adhesives, this powder adapts well to various environments. But why should you, as a consumer or a producer, care about it in the realm of food packaging?
You might wonder, "Is polyvinyl alcohol powder safe for my food?" The answer is generally a resounding yes. According to several studies, polyvinyl alcohol is considered non-toxic and biodegradable. The World Health Organization (WHO) has recognized it as safe for food contact, given that it passes stringent tests for substances that could migrate into food.
However, it's essential to note that any material can pose risks if not used properly. Adhering to regulations and proper usage guidelines ensures that you reap the benefits of polyvinyl alcohol powder without any safety concerns.
So, what are the actual benefits of using polyvinyl alcohol powder in food packaging? One of the standout advantages is its excellent barrier properties. It can prevent moisture and oxygen from entering packaged foods, which significantly extends shelf life. Studies have shown that food products packaged in polyvinyl alcohol films stay fresher up to 50% longer compared to traditional packaging.
Additionally, it’s worth mentioning the environmental upside. In a world increasingly focused on sustainability, polyvinyl alcohol is gaining traction because it’s biodegradable. The use of this material helps reduce plastic waste, making it a more sustainable choice for manufacturers and consumers alike.

Let's talk innovation. The development of polyvinyl alcohol powder has paved the way for advancements in food safety. Researchers are continuously improving the properties of this material to enhance its effectiveness in packaging. For instance, modifications to the molecular structure of polyvinyl alcohol have led to increased strength and flexibility, which are critical in packaging applications. This is not just a win for manufacturers but also for consumers who desire durable, reliable packaging.
Moreover, the rise of smart packaging technologies has integrated polyvinyl alcohol with sensors that can monitor food quality. Imagine buying a pack of meat that could tell you if it's still fresh or not! With technology evolving rapidly, the applications of polyvinyl alcohol are only bound to expand.
